The 2019 Domaine Georges Vernay St Agathe Syrah is a red wine hailing from the Collines Rhodaniennes region of France. Produced by Georges Vernay, this wine is crafted entirely from Syrah grapes and has an alcohol content of 14.0%. The wine is sealed with a traditional cork closure.
Decanter awarded this wine a score of 92 points. They describe it as having "a gorgeous, soaring nose of violets and rose, Turkish delight and pink peppercorns." The review highlights its light body and vibrant character, noting that it has "lovely acidity that really cuts through the wine." While the finish is not particularly long, it is "explosively aromatic." Decanter suggests that this wine is a good alternative if your budget doesn't allow for a Côte-Rôtie from the blonde side.
Vinous gave this wine an excellent review, scoring it 93 points. Their tasting notes describe the wine as having "deep, shimmering ruby" color with "mineral-accented aromas of ripe red and blue fruits, violet and exotic spices." On the palate, the wine is "sappy and energetic," offering flavors of "gently sweet cherry and blueberry" that deepen with exposure to air, showing "fine delineation." Vinous also notes that the blue fruit flavors drive a "very long, mineral finish" with a subtle grip provided by fine-grained tannins. They assert that this bottling can stand up to and even surpass many wines from Côte-Rôtie.
